Introduction: Understanding Eco-Friendly Land Clearing

Land cleaning is a vital procedure for different projects, varying from farming to construction. Nonetheless, traditional land clearing approaches commonly lead to substantial ecological effects, including soil erosion, habitat damage, and enhanced carbon exhausts. This is where forestry mulching enters the scene as a cutting edge technique for eco-friendly land management.

Forestry mulching includes the use of specialized equipment to shred vegetation into mulch on-site. This method not only lessens the environmental impact yet also supplies numerous benefits over conventional clearing up techniques like bush hogging and excavation. The Advantages of Forestry Mulching for Eco-Friendly Land Clearing

When discussing green land clearing approaches, one should take into consideration the various benefits that forestry mulching brings to the table. This method has actually gotten appeal among property owners and specialists alike permanently factors:

Reduced Environmental Impact

Unlike traditional land clearing methods that may involve burning or chemical therapies, forestry mulching utilizes tools such as excavators and skid steers equipped with mulching heads to grind trees and brush right into little pieces. The resulting mulch can be left on-site to decompose normally, boosting dirt health without introducing harmful substances.

Soil Conservation

Dirt disintegration is a significant worry when executing land clearing tasks. By leaving the shredded greenery on the ground, forestry mulching assists shield the dirt framework and avoid erosion, which is particularly critical in hilly or irregular terrain.

Typical land clearing can be an extensive procedure including multiple stages-- from reducing trees to hauling particles away. With forestry mulching, the whole operation can commonly be completed in eventually or much less, considerably reducing labor prices and time frames.

How Does Forestry Mulching Work?

1. Devices Used in Forestry Mulching

The secret to effective forestry mulching hinges on making use of specialized machinery designed for this objective:

    Excavators: These devices are equipped with sturdy add-ons efficient in shredding big trees and thick brush quickly. Skid Guides: Compact yet effective, skid steers offer versatility in steering through limited spaces while properly handling smaller sized debris. Mulchers: Certain attachments developed for both excavators and skid guides enable operators to execute precise grinding jobs efficiently.

2. The Process Explained

The typical procedure of forestry mulching consists of:

Assessing the site: An assessment of plant life thickness and type aids establish devices needs. Clearing particles: Operators use excavators or skid guides fitted with mulchers to shred unwanted vegetation. Spreading mulch: The resulting compost is uniformly dispersed over the area.

Comparing Forestry Mulching with Standard Methods

1. Bush Hogging vs. Forestry Mulching

Bush hogging involves making use of rotary cutters to mow down disordered locations but leaves behind huge clumps of plants that might call for further cleaning up afterward.

In contrast, forestry mulching shreds all vegetation right into fine compost that breaks down normally without leaving behind too much debris-- a reliable option for those aiming to clear land without complications.

2. Excavator-Based Methods

While excavators are frequently used in both standard land clearing methods and forestry mulching, their application differs considerably:

    In standard techniques, they may root out trees entirely. In forestry mulching scenarios, they merely grind them down right into compost while maintaining soil integrity.
